Why the Market is Growing

The Skin Sensors Market is experiencing robust growth due to the demand for non-invasive, continuous health monitoring. Consumers and healthcare professionals increasingly rely on real-time tracking of hydration, glucose, cortisol, and electrolyte levels without invasive procedures. Integration with wearables and IoT platforms enables personalized health insights, remote patient monitoring, and subscription-based wellness services. Personalized skincare trends further propel adoption, particularly in markets like Asia-Pacific and North America.

Drivers, Opportunities, Trends, Challenges

Rising Demand for Continuous and Non-Invasive Health Monitoring Skin sensors offer non-invasive, real-time monitoring of hydration, glucose, temperature, and stress biomarkers. They eliminate the need for bulky equipment, enabling comfortable at-home and clinical use, particularly for chronic disease management and preventive care.

Advancements in Flexible Electronics and Sensor Miniaturization Innovations in nanomaterials, microelectronics, and stretchable substrates have made sensors ultra-thin, breathable, and skin-conformal. Enhanced accuracy, comfort, and durability expand use across healthcare, dermatology, fitness, and occupational safety, while wireless integration enables remote data transmission.

Data Privacy and Regulatory Compliance Challenges Sensitive biometric data requires adherence to privacy laws such as GDPR and HIPAA. Regulatory approvals, clinical validation, and interoperability with electronic health records can slow adoption and increase development costs, particularly for startups entering medical-grade sensor markets.

Convergence with AI-Driven Wellness Platforms Integration of skin sensor data with AI and cloud analytics enables predictive insights in hydration, stress, sleep, and metabolic health. Consumer apps and dashboards provide personalized feedback, while clinical algorithms assist early diagnosis, supporting a shift toward preventive and biofeedback-focused healthcare.
